Fox News owner Rupert Murdoch has publicly thanked workers of Britain's National Health Service for vaccinating him against COVID-19. This, as Fox News personality Tucker Carlson urged his audience to look at the vaccine with skepticism. According to Business Insider, Carlson said on 'Tucker Carlson Tonight' Thursday, the vaccine 'feels false, because it is. It's too slick' Meanwhile, Murdoch, 89, and his wife Jerry Hall Murdoch, have been isolating at their home in Oxfordshire, England, for most of the pandemic. I strongly encourage people around the world to get the vaccine as it becomes available. Rupert Murdoch Owner, Fox News

After a month-long argument with the Great State of California, Tesla founder Elon Musk has had enough. According to Business Insider, Musk confirmed on Tuesday that he has moved to Texas. Musk began extricating himself when local COVID-19 restrictions forced Tesla to temporarily close its only US car factory in the Bay Area. Over the summer, as he sold many Los Angeles-area homes, Musk also quietly moved his charitable foundation to Texas. At a virtual conference on Tuesday, Musk pointedly noted Tesla owns the last car manufacturing plant in the entire state of California.
